Overview

The Opportunity: 

 

General Dynamics Electric Boat, the world’s foremost designer and builder of nuclear submarines, is seeking a Network Engineers to join the organization within the  Information Technology (EBIT) Department.

 

Position Summary:

 

The individual in this position will possess the ability to apply subject matter knowledge to solve complex business problems, while also frequently contributing to the development of new ideas and methods.

 

The responsibilities of this position will include, but are not limited to, the following: 

  • Solve and execute on complex problems where analysis of situations or data requires an in-depth evaluation of multiple factors.
  • Provide expertise to functional project teams and participate in cross-functional initiatives.
  • Function independently with significant individual judgment within broadly defined policies and practices to determine best method for accomplishing work and achieving objectives

Qualifications

Required:

 

  • Bachelors of Science in IT or related technical degree
  • 5+ years related Network IT experience (senior or above)
  • Cisco Certified Network Associate (CCNA) Certification (equivalent IT certifications) plus Palo Alto Networks Certified Network Security Engineer (PCNSE) (or equivalent) 
  • Demonstrated experience as a network solution architect in a global infrastructure environment, including SDWAN

Preferred:

  • Strong experience in planning, designing, installing, configuring & troubleshooting Routers/Switches and firewalls in the field.
  • Strong experience in Firewall configurations using Next Gen Firewalls, such as Palo Alto Networks.
  • Demonstrated experience and knowledge in Wireless network administration, experience in Aruba Network is an added advantage.
  • Strong understanding of the OSPF and BGP routing protocols.
  • Strong understanding of layer 2 and layer 3 switching protocols.
  • Strong understanding of the following: HSRP, DSCP, NAT/SNAT, TCP/IP, Multicast, Ethernet.
  • Strong familiarity with the following WAN technologies: Carrier provided MPLS, VPN, and SD-WAN.
  • Ability to install, configure and troubleshoot OS network issues in Windows and Linux.
  • Strong understanding of DHCP, DNS/domain services.
  • Strong experience in VPN, IPSec, GRE, SSL tunnels and F5 BigIP.
  • Strong experience in cloud based networking.

Skills

The ideal candidate will possess the following: 

  • Project management knowledge or experience with excellent analytical and problem solving skills, including appropriate due diligence.
  • Possess creative ability, consulting skills, leadership qualities, credibility and self-confidence. Influencing skills and ability to work effectively in a geographically dispersed team.
  • Demonstrated technical leadership skills. Ability to translate business needs into technical requirements and solutions.
